The Mazatlan Mixe of Mexico

The Mazatlan Mixe of Mexico, numbering approximately 19,500 people, are No Longer Unreached.
They are described as an ethnolinguistic community of Mexico .
They are an Indigenous people, with Mixe as their ethnic/kinship group and are in the Mixe people cluster of the Latin-Caribbean Americans.
Their primary religion is Christianity - Folk Catholicism.
They primarily speak Spanish.
